In a unique school campus environment, it is critical to conduct training exercises, but this can be difficult to accomplish with existing methodologies. Many states have implemented legal requirements for “trauma-informed” training without defining alternatives. There are recent news reports of training gone bad as live exercises are mishandled. This presentation focuses on training for active threats with no fear component and how to move beyond the standard Run, Hide, Fight methodology and lockdown, to actual discussions of management processes.
What you will learn by attending:
- A methodology for performing crisis management exercises which is trauma-free, non-disruptive, and entirely relevant to their unique organizational culture.
- How to build facility-specific crisis management processes by engaging front-line staff.
- Specific case studies of how drills helped improve, clarify, and streamline existing processes that make crisis response vastly more effective and saved precious time and resources.
